CAS 210282-31-8
:fmoc-l-3-iodophenylalanine
Description:
Fmoc-L-3-iodophenylalanine is a modified amino acid commonly used in peptide synthesis and research. It features a phenylalanine backbone with an iodine atom substituted at the meta position of the aromatic ring, which can influence the compound's reactivity and properties. The Fmoc (9-fluorenylmethoxycarbonyl) group serves as a protective group for the amino functionality, allowing for selective deprotection during peptide synthesis. This compound is typically utilized in solid-phase peptide synthesis due to its stability and ease of handling. Its unique characteristics, such as the presence of the iodine atom, can enhance the biological activity of peptides, making it valuable in medicinal chemistry and drug development. Additionally, the Fmoc group facilitates purification and characterization of peptides. Overall, Fmoc-L-3-iodophenylalanine is a versatile building block in the field of peptide chemistry, contributing to the synthesis of complex biomolecules with potential therapeutic applications.
Formula:C24H20INO4
